Here is my contribution to gu-playing so far.
Spherical harmonics, just calculated on main cpu, all drawing via sceGu.
Mainly to demonstrate diff rendermodes, includes wireframe, solid, lit,textured and envmapped.
Is also comitted as a sample within PSPSDK for those grabbing from svn.
here is the url (kindly hosted by warren)
http://kelley.ca/psp/adresd_spharm_1.zip
it does go through some random values, just interpolating, so can get a bit crazy at times. Just bear with it :)
